Album Info:

  • Artist: Def Leppard
  • Title: "Hysteria"
  • Recorded: 1986 through 1987 at Wisseloord Studios in Hilversum, Holland 
  • Release date: August 3rd, 1987 (4th studio album by Def Leppard)
  • Record company: Mercury Records
  • Production: Robert "Mutt" Lange and Def Leppard
  • Album cover art: Andie Airfix
  • Personnel: Rick Allen (drums and percussion), Steve Clark (guitars and backing vocals), Phil Collen (guitars and backing vocals), Joe Elliott (lead vocals), and Rick Savage (bass and backing vocals)
  • Additional musicians: Robert "Mutt" Lange (backing vocals) and Philip Nicholas (keyboards and programming)
  • Musical style: Hard rock, heavy metal, hair metal, power pop
  • Sound:  Okay, so I will admit that this album is completely over-produced... it is at times fluffy, poppy, and very un-metal, and was what took this band from being a pretty cool metal band to becoming pretty-boy MTV darlings.  However, I must admit, I love this album!  It is fun as hell to listen to!  Although somewhat hidden by the latest sonic technology effects of the late '80s, the late Steve Clark's guitar work is still wonderfully textured, thoughtfully delivered, and what keeps the "metal" element alive in each track.  (Just listen to that tone at the beginning of "Animal" and the solo work of "Love Bites" or the power of "Gods Of War.")  There are elements that seem dated by today's standards (Casio-like synth effects), but overall, there is a timelessness to the tracks of "Hysteria."  Songs like the title track, "Animal", "Women," super-hit "Pour Some Sugar On Me," "Run Riot," and "Love And Affection" have all become part of rock and roll vernacular and recognized by kids to this day.  Say what you will of integrity, but that speaks volumes in terms of staying power and good songwriting. 
  • Major themes: Love, loss, heartbreak, lust, desire, sex, life, relationships, war, violence, etc.
  • Notes: "Hysteria" is Def Leppard best-selling album to date, selling over 20 million copies worldwide.  The album took over three years to record, produce, and release and was plagued by multiple delays, including the car accident where drummer Rick Allen lost his arm.

Brew Info:

  • Brewery: Odell Brewing Company
  • Website: https://www.odellbrewing.com/
  • Brew: Hazer Tag Hazy IPA
  • Style: India Pale Ale (IPA
  • Serving: 12 ounce can
  • ABV: 7.0% 
  • IBUs: 38
  • Pour: The Hazer Tag pours a very hazy, golden-yellow hue with a huge billowy and foamy 2+ finger, bright white head with great retention and lots of sticky, spider web lacing.
  • Nose: The nose is citrusy, tropical, floral, and malty.  There are aromas of freshly squeezed orange juice, tangerine, lime zest, passion fruit, guava, fresh mango, soft peach, wildflowers, light cereal grains, and a hint of honey.
  • Taste: The taste of the Hazer Tag follows the nose with lots of fruity, citrusy, and malty flavors.  There are notes of passion fruit, guava, mango, orange juice, tangerine, pineapple, light pink grapefruit juice, and soft caramel.
  • Mouthfeel: Medium-bodied with good carbonation, the mouthfeel is very crisp, juicy with a fairly clean, dry, and slightly bitter finish.
